About My Clients
I work with teens, young adults, and parents navigating anxiety, depression, life transitions, identity questions, and feeling stuck or overwhelmed. Whether you're a student facing academic or social pressure, a young adult adjusting to independence, or a parent seeking support for your own mental health, I offer a warm, relatable space to feel heard and supported. Together, we’ll build insight, confidence, and real tools to help you move forward with clarity and resilience.
My Background and Approach
At 25, I bring a fresh and relatable perspective to therapy—especially for teens, college students, and young adults navigating anxiety, depression, life transitions, trauma, and identity questions. As a Licensed Professional Counselor at Inner Strength Therapy, I offer individual therapy for adolescents, young adults, and parents in a space that feels genuine, supportive, and free of judgment. I’m close enough in age to understand the cultural and digital pressures younger clients face today, while still offering the structure and experience to help guide real progress. My approach is client-centered and flexible, pulling from CBT, mindfulness, and person-centered therapy. My background includes working in college counseling, inpatient child psychiatry, and private practice. Whether you're a young person figuring things out or a parent seeking support for yourself or your teen, I’ll meet you where you are—with warmth, empathy, and a focus on meaningful growth.
My Personal Beliefs and Interests
I believe therapy should be a place where you feel truly seen, heard, and accepted—without judgment or stigma. My passion for mental health comes from personal experience. In high school, I lost classmates to suicide, and those losses deeply impacted me, showing just how important it is to have open, honest conversations and support long before things feel overwhelming. I want everyone to know that asking for help is not a sign of weakness, but a brave and powerful step toward healing and growth. My goal is to create a safe, welcoming space where you can bring your whole self, feel truly understood, and start making meaningful, positive changes in your life.
